PBI-Gordon Extends End-User EOP for Hurricane-Affected Areas

By |  October 19, 2017 0 Comments

PBI-Gordon Corp. is extending the company’s October End-User Early Order Program (EOP) deadline for hurricane-affected states in the south and southeast, the company says in a press release.

To give them more time to focus on recovery efforts, PBI-Gordon customers in Alabama, Florida, Georgia, Louisiana, Mississippi, North Carolina, South Carolina and Texas will have until Nov. 30, 2017 to take advantage of the maximum rebate allowed for their specific purchases.

“Weather is everything in our business, and this hurricane season has been devastating,” says Doug Obermann, PBI-Gordon vice president of professional and agricultural sales. “Our distributor and end-user partners in affected areas have enough work to do without having to worry about early-order pricing deadlines.”
